Can a genie be used as a modulator
I have a little Direct TV Genie (Model: C41-500) box that isnt being used. I have a TV monitor in a spare bedroom that i want to hook my outdoor over the air antenna to. The TV doesnt have a TV tuner in it so there isnt a place to connect a coax cable to.
My question, is there a way to use this genie as a modulator to connect the over the air antenna to the TV to view over the air digital channels?
So the coax cable would connect to the coax outlet in the house and then connect to the Direct TV genie, then an HDMI cable would go from the Direct TV genie to the HDMI port on the TV.

Nope. DirecTV DVRs/Genies have no off-air tuners. But you can buy stand-alone off-air tuners for this purpose. You'll find lots of them on Amazon, for example ....
